2 arrested for DUI at Lancaster checkpoint

by The AV Times Staff • February 10, 2014

LANCASTER – Two suspected DUI drivers and a driver with a $35K traffic warrant were among those arrested at a DUI/Driver’s License Checkpoint in Lancaster this past Friday (Feb. 7).

The operation was conducted from 6 p.m. to 2 a.m. on westbound Avenue L at 27th Street West in Lancaster.

The results of the checkpoint are as follows:

* 1136 vehicles traveled through the checkpoint.

* 1063 drivers Checked at the Checkpoint.

* One DUI – Drug (marijuana) suspect arrested.

* One DUI – alcohol suspect arrested.

* One suspect was arrested for a $35K traffic warrant and sent to court.

* Two suspended/revoked license drivers were arrested and sent to court.

* Six unlicensed drivers were arrested and sent to court.

* One vehicle was stored for one day.

* Two vehicles were impounded for 30 days.

* Five vehicles were released per checkpoint release procedures.

The checkpoint was funded by a grant from the State of California’s Office of Traffic Safety (OTS) thru the Business, Transportation and Housing Agency.
